The Importance of Mechanical Quilting in Saddle Production
Mechanical quilting is a technique that involves stitching multiple layers of fabric together to create a padded effect. This method is particularly relevant in saddle manufacturing, where comfort and durability are paramount. The following sections will explore why mechanical quilting machines are essential for efficient and high-quality saddle production.
1. Enhanced Efficiency in Production
One of the most significant advantages of using mechanical quilting machines in saddle manufacturing is the enhancement of production efficiency. These machines can operate at high speeds, allowing manufacturers to produce saddles in larger quantities without compromising on quality. Key benefits include:
- **Rapid Production Cycles**: Mechanical quilting machines can significantly reduce the time it takes to complete each saddle, enabling manufacturers to meet tight deadlines.
- **Consistent Quality**: Automation ensures that every quilted layer is uniform, leading to consistent saddle quality across production runs.
- **Reduced Labor Costs**: With machines handling the bulk of the quilting work, manufacturers can allocate human resources to other critical areas of the production process.
2. Improved Quality Control
Quality control is a crucial aspect of saddle manufacturing, and mechanical quilting machines contribute significantly to maintaining high standards. The precision engineering behind these machines ensures that every stitch is placed correctly, resulting in:
- **Enhanced Durability**: Properly quilted layers provide added strength, ensuring that saddles can withstand the rigors of use over time.
- **Minimized Defects**: Automated quilting drastically reduces human error, leading to fewer defective products entering the market.
- **Customizable Stitch Patterns**: Advanced quilting machines allow for intricate and customizable stitch designs, further enhancing the aesthetic appeal of the saddles.
3. Versatile Applications in Various Saddle Types
Mechanical quilting machines adapt to different types of saddles, including Western, English, and specialized riding saddles. This versatility means that manufacturers can use the same equipment for various production lines, providing several advantages:
- **Flexibility in Production**: As market demands shift, manufacturers can quickly reconfigure their machines to accommodate different styles and designs.
- **Cost-Effective Solutions**: Investing in versatile quilting machines allows manufacturers to avoid purchasing multiple specialized machines, reducing overall capital expenditure.
- **Streamlined Inventory Management**: A consistent quilting method across different saddle types simplifies inventory management, making it easier to track materials and finished products.
Key Features of Mechanical Quilting Machines
Understanding the features of mechanical quilting machines helps manufacturers make an informed decision when selecting the right equipment. Here are some key features that underscore their importance:
1. High-Speed Operation
Mechanical quilting machines are designed to operate at high speeds, significantly reducing production time. With some machines capable of stitching several hundred layers per minute, manufacturers can scale up their operations without sacrificing quality.
2. Precision Stitching
The precision offered by mechanical quilting machines is unmatched. They can adjust stitch length and tension automatically, ensuring that every quilted layer adheres perfectly. This level of precision is crucial for maintaining the overall integrity of the saddle.
3. User-Friendly Interfaces
Modern mechanical quilting machines come equipped with intuitive user interfaces that simplify the operation process. Users can easily program various stitch patterns and monitor production metrics, enhancing overall productivity.
4. Long-Lasting Durability
Investing in high-quality mechanical quilting machines means selecting equipment built to withstand the rigors of daily use. Durable components and robust construction ensure that these machines remain operational for years, providing excellent long-term value.

Maintenance and Care for Mechanical Quilting Machines
To ensure longevity and optimal performance of mechanical quilting machines, proper maintenance is essential. Here are some best practices:
1. Regular Cleaning
Keeping machines free from dust and debris is critical. Regular cleaning helps prevent malfunctions and ensures smooth operation.
2. Scheduled Maintenance Checks
Routine maintenance checks by qualified technicians can identify potential issues before they become serious problems. Scheduling these checks at regular intervals prolongs the life of the machine.
3. Use of Quality Materials
Using high-quality threads and fabrics minimizes wear and tear on machines. Investing in premium materials enhances the overall quilted finish and machine performance.
